Bo–Landing the May cover from L’Officiel Mexico, Bo Don takes on menswear inspired looks for the magazine’s main fashion feature. The short haired babe poses for Max Abadian in the images where she models designs from the spring collections of Salvatore Ferragamo, Proenza Schouler, Celine and more styled by Christopher Campbell. The mix of sharply tailored suiting and relaxed silhouettes is inspiring for the new season. / Hair by Ayumi Yamamoto, Makeup by Manami Ishikawa
